Respawn Entertainment is gearing up for its Season 3 launch in early October which could bring the next Legend into the Apex Games for players to compete with. Even though the devs have been quiet on the character, they’ve given plenty of clues for the Legend to hold fans over until his release.

But players might have just received the best look at what Crypto will look like when he finally hits the official servers since he’s been spotted deep inside Singh Labs Interior.

In a Reddit post, user ‘FrozenFroh’ highlighted Crypto in the middle of breaching yet another computer, but made a quick escape after noticing he’d been discovered.

Making their way through a debris-covered doorway, the player sees the character in his white jacket with his back turned. Though it seems like his robotic companion tips him off on the incoming player.

It looks like Crypto’s Aerial Drone went into attack mode a bit too, as his middle sensor turned into a pin-point red dot similar to a HAL 9000.

Shortly after getting found out, Crypto quickly ends his hack leaving his signature digital mark on the screen above the computer console. As he dashes away his robotic companion takes a brief moment to realize they’re choosing flight instead of fight, and promptly follows suit.

Respawn respond to Crypto’s first sighting

Shortly after the post made it to the front page of the community subreddit, a handful of developers responded, trying to throw players off the trail.

Producer Josh Medina simply replied ‘Who?’, playing coy, while another dev, Rayme Vinson joked that they may have in fact changed Crypto’s name to ‘Jimmy McHackington III’.

Another developer joked that the leaked game files indicating that the name is definitely Crypto are actually a reference to Bitcoin, and nothing to do with the eleventh Apex Legend.
